titleOfInvention |
Conductive fiber, method for producing the same, and conductive resin composition |
abstract |
(57) [Abstract] [PROBLEMS] To obtain a conductive fiber that exhibits stable conductivity and has little elution of alkali ions and the like. A coating layer containing 0.1 to 20% by weight of one or more metals selected from the group consisting of antimony, indium, and niobium, and the balance substantially consisting of tin oxide is provided. 5 to 70% by weight, It is characterized in that it is provided on the surface of fibers such as fibrous potassium aluminate titanate. |
